A most elegant equation : Euler's formula and the beauty of mathematics / David Stipp.

Author: Stipp, David, author.

ImprintNew York : Basic Books, 2017.

Descriptionviii, 221 pages : illustrations ; 22 cm

Note:God's equation -- A constant that's all about change -- It even comes down the chimney -- The number between being and not-being -- Portrait of the master -- Through the wormhole -- From triangles to seesaws -- Reggie's problem -- Putting it together -- A new spin on Euler's formula -- The meaning of it all -- Appendix: Euler's original derivation.

Bibliography Note:Includes bibliographical references (pages 193-210) and index.

Note:Explains the beauty of mathematics by examining Euler's equation, sometimes called God's equation, that ties together basic arithmetic, compound interest, trigonometry, calculus, and infinity.
